"Obstruction.

50A. Any person who obstructs -

(a) any member of Her Majesty's forces;

(b)

any member of the Royal Hong Kong Defence

Force; or

(c) any other person,

exercising any powers or performing any duties conferred

or imposed on him by this Ordinance or by any orders,

directions, requirements or notices made there under

shall be guilty of an offence and shall be liable on

summary conviction to a fine of one thousand dollars

and to imprisonment for six months.".
